The Philippines 20 Years Government Bond has a 6.786% yield (last update 2 Oct 2023 2:15 GMT+0).
Yield changed +7.8 bp during last week, -2.1 bp during last month, -39.4 bp during last year.

Data Source: from 11 Sep 2016 to 2 Oct 2023
The Philippines 20 Years Government Bond reached a maximum yield of 9.015% (16 October 2018) and a minimum yield of 3.223% (17 August 2020).
